asymptote

Pronunciation: /ˈasɪm(p)təʊt/
Definition of asymptote

noun

  • a straight line that continually approaches a given curve but does not meet it at any finite distance.

Derivatives

asymptotic

adjective

asymptotically

adverb

Origin:

mid 17th century: from modern Latin asymptota (linea) '(line) not meeting', from Greek asumptōtos 'not falling together', from a- 'not' + sun 'together' + ptōtos 'apt to fall' (from piptein 'to fall')
